Trimble receives Nasdaq deficiency notice for late Q2 10-Q; extension granted for Q1
TRIMBLE INC.
- Nasdaq notified Trimble on Aug 16 that it is not in compliance with Listing Rule 5250(c)(1) due to failure to timely file Q2 Form 10-Q (period ended June 28, 2024).
- Trimble has until Aug 31, 2024 to submit an update to its previously submitted compliance plan; Nasdaq may grant an extension.
- Nasdaq on Aug 16 granted Trimble a full extension until Nov 11, 2024 to regain compliance for the delinquent Q1 10-Q filing.
- The Q2 Notice does not immediately affect the listing or trading of Trimble's common stock on Nasdaq.
